Enumeration and Exploitation Labs

Professional penetration testing labs documenting reconnaissance, enumeration, exploitation, privilege escalation, post-exploitation, and attack surface analysis across Windows, Linux, web applications, and network services.

Status License Platform Focus


Overview

This repository contains hands-on penetration testing assessments and lab reports developed while studying offensive security, network enumeration, exploitation methodologies, and post-exploitation techniques.

The goal of this repository is to document the complete penetration testing lifecycle in a structured and professional manner while building a practical cybersecurity portfolio.


Assessment Methodology

Reconnaissance
      │
      ▼
Host Discovery
      │
      ▼
Port Enumeration
      │
      ▼
Service Enumeration
      │
      ▼
Vulnerability Assessment
      │
      ▼
Exploitation
      │
      ▼
Privilege Escalation
      │
      ▼
Post Exploitation
      │
      ▼
Reporting
